Two Waukegan High School teachers were recently honored by the
Association of Filipino American Teachers of America (AFTA) for their
positive impact as educators.
Gina Villaruz, a teacher with Program PLACCE at Waukegan High School,
and Imelda Mendoza, a Physics teacher at the WHS-Brookside Campus, each
received the Crystal Apple Service Award during an AFTA award ceremony
in New York City last month.
The AFTA recognized Ms. Mendoza’s and Ms. Villaruz’s 31 years of
combined service as educators, as well as their contributions and
enduring commitment to their profession. The award was presented by
Philippine Consul General and Ambassador to the United States Claro S.
Cristobal.
AFTA is a New York-based non-profit organization of Filipino Educators,
whose mission is to promote the advancement of the teaching profession
and education as a whole in the Philippines and the United States.
